Most people think more is better. In the world of aquarium sand depth, that is a lie. A shallow sand bed is typically defined as everything in the middle of 0.5 inches and 1.5 inches. Why go this thin? First, its about flow. In a freshwater sand bed, debris often settles on the surface. If the bed is deep, that gunk sinks and rots. In a shallow setup, the water flow keeps detritus moving. Your filter actually catches it. Imagine that.

Using the Sand Aquarium Calculator: The Step-by-Step Breakdown
Lets acquire into the nitty-gritty. How get you actually complete the math? Most people find math boring. I find it expensive to ignore. To calculate your substrate needs, you infatuation the dimensions of your tank. This isn't rocket science, but people nevertheless mess it up. You compulsion the internal length and the internal width. Don't piece of legislation the outside of the glass. That quarter-inch of glass on both sides adds up.
The all right formula for pounds of sand per gallon or sum volume is: (Length x Width x Desired Depth) / 17.28. This gives you the cubic inches converted to a more simple number. But sand isn't sold by the cubic inch. Its sold by the pound. This is where the sand aquarium capacity calculator calculator gets tricky. rotate sands have every other weights. Aragonite is lighter than garnet sand. action sand is somewhere in the middle.
For a shallow bed, I usually suggest a 1-inch target. If your tank is 48 inches long and 18 inches wide, you pull off the math. 48 epoch 18 is 864. Multiply that by 1 inch. You nevertheless have 864. Divide that by 17.28, and you acquire 50. But thats 50... what? Thats nearly 50 pounds of average-density sand. If you are measure a marine aquarium sand setup behind good oolite, you might habit less weight for the similar volume. If you use stifling silica sand, you might obsession 60 pounds.
